Summary

The Lakers are going turning back to the dreaded 3 guard lineup now that Spencer Dinwiddie is in town, but could it work out this time? Trevor Lane explains why we shouldn't overreact, plus we preview Lakers vs Pistons and the Lakers' apparent 3-star plan for this summer...
